چکیده مقاله:
During the las t years, organoid models have become a powerfultool to s tudy lung development and disease. Our research focuson the use of three-dimensional lung organoid sys tems fromadult somatic s tem cells and induced pluripotent s tem cells (iPSCs)for modeling of lung development and disease aiming atthe es tablishment of novel therapeutic s trategies. For ins tance,we es tablished a ۳D murine bronchioalveolar lung organoid(BALO) model that allows clonal expansion and self-organizationof FACS-sorted bronchioalveolar s tem cells (BASCs)upon co-culture with lung-resident mesenchymal cells. BALOsyield a highly branched ۳D s tructure within ۲۱ days of culture, mimicking the cellular composition of the bronchioalveolarcompartment as defined by single-cell RNA sequencingand fluorescence as well as electron microscopic phenotyping.Additionally, BALOs support engraftment and maintenanceof different cell types thereby open numerous new avenues tos tudy lung development, infection, and regenerative processesin vitro.
